The seven-seater segment has seen a lot of activity in the last 12 to 15 months. We have seen multiple affordable as well as premium seven-seaters launch. Even with the launch of Kia Carens, Maruti continues to dominate the affordable seven-seater segment with the Ertiga and XL6. But Maruti doesn’t want to stay restricted to this segment. The brand now wants to take on some premium seven-seater SUVs. With a new car, Maruti wants to take on the likes of Tata Safari, Mahindra XUV700, MG Hector Plus and Hyundai Alcazar. So what is Maruti’s plan? In today’s article, let’s talk about this Maruti Safari rival.

As mentioned above, Maruti wants to target the premium seven-seater segment. So why does Maruti want to enter the premium segment? Of late, Maruti has been aiming to upgrade its image from an affordable car manufacturer to a premium SUV maker. We have seen this with the unveil of the Grand Vitara. Also, Maruti has been adding modern features to its cars to improve the premium quotient of its cars.

The Safari rival is touted to be based on the Ertiga platform with some modifications. This SUV will most probably become the brand’s flagship SUV in the Indian market once launched. What engine options could it get? This is hard to guess considering Maruti lacks powerful engine options for such an SUV. With that being said, we expect Maruti to make hybrid options the strong point for this product. This is similar to what we have seen with the Grand Vitara.

Maruti has seen the growth of the SUV segment in the past few years and aims to launch an SUV in all segments. The first of these will be the launch of the Grand Vitara. After that, we could see the Baleno Cross. According to reports, Maruti could unveil it at the Auto Expo 2023. After the Baleno Cross, Maruti could launch the much-awaited Jimny 5-door in India. What about the Safari rival? The Safari rival is still in its early stages of development, so it is hard to speculate about its launch. Maruti will also be stepping up its EV game with a mid-size electric SUV.
